Overview

This clinical trial investigates multi-modality imaging and collection of biospecimen samples in understanding bone marrow changes in patients with acute myeloid leukemia undergoing total body irradiation (TBI) and chemotherapy. Using multi-modality imaging and collecting biospecimen samples may help doctors know more about how TBI and chemotherapy can change the bone marrow.

Description

PRIMARY OBJECTIVES:

I. Temporal assessment of treatment impact on bone marrow. II. Relative assessment of bone marrow status between total marrow and lymphoid irradiation (TMLI) and conventional TBI.

SECONDARY OBJECTIVES:

I. Correlation of dual energy computed tomography (DECT), magnetic resonance imaging (MRI) imaging with biological samples for cellularity/adiposity.

II. Feasibility of fluorothymidine F-18 (FLT) positron emission tomography (PET) imaging biomarker as a predictor of treatment response.

III. Correlation of FLT PET imaging with biological correlate for leukemia. IV. Characterize relative distribution of leukemia in bone marrow (BM) environment.

OUTLINE: Patients are assigned to 1 of 2 cohorts.

COHORT I (TLMI+FLT/TMLI): Patients may undergo optional fluorothymidine F-18 PET scan over 2 hours at baseline, on days 30 and 100, at 1 year, and at time of relapse. Patients undergo DECT and water-fat MRI scan over 30 minutes at baseline, on days 30 and 100, at year 1, and at time of relapse. Patients also undergo collection of bone marrow and blood samples at baseline, on days 30 and 100, and at 1 year. Patients undergo fluorothymidine F-18 PET, DECT, and water-fat MRI as in TMLI+FLT.

COHORT II (TBI): Patients undergo collection of bone marrow at baseline, day 30, time of relapse, and at 1 year.

Eligibility

Inclusion Criteria:

  • Cohort TMLI+FLT: AML patients eligible for and enrolling on COH 14012 or IRB 17505 that agree to participate in optional FLT PET imaging
    • Note: patients enrolling on IRB 19518 cannot enroll onto this cohort, but they may enroll on Cohort TMLI (below)
  • Cohort TMLI: AML or ALL patients eligible for and enrolling on COH 14012, IRB 17505 or

    IRB 19518

  • Cohort TBI: First or second remission AML or ALL patients that will receive TBI (13.2 Gy) plus chemotherapy (etoposide [VP16] 60 mg/kg or cyclophosphamide [Cy] 60 mg/kg for two days) as part of their standard of care
  • Cohort TBI: Documented written informed consent of participant
  • Cohort TBI: Age >= 18 to =< 60 years
  • Cohort TBI: Patients who have not received a prior transplant

What is a clinical trial?

A clinical trial is a study designed to test specific interventions or treatments' effectiveness and safety, paving the way for new, innovative healthcare solutions.

Why should I take part in a clinical trial?

Participating in a clinical trial provides early access to potentially effective treatments and directly contributes to the healthcare advancements that benefit us all.

How long does a clinical trial take place?

The duration of clinical trials varies. Some trials last weeks, some years, depending on the phase and intention of the trial.

Do I get compensated for taking part in clinical trials?

Compensation varies per trial. Some offer payment or reimbursement for time and travel, while others may not.

How safe are clinical trials?

Clinical trials follow strict ethical guidelines and protocols to safeguard participants' health. They are closely monitored and safety reviewed regularly.
